Siga Technologies, Inc. (SIGA)

Founded in 1995, SIGA is a commercial-stage pharmaceutical company that focuses on infectious diseases as well as the health security markets in the United States. The company’s lead product, TPOXX, is an orally administered antiviral drug used for treating human smallpox disease caused by the variola virus.

In March, SIGA and Cipla Therapeutics  formed a strategic partnership to offer access to novel antibacterial drugs and deliver innovative solutions for biothreat and public health needs, like AMR (anti-microbial resistance). The collaboration is expected to benefit from the Biomedical Advanced Research and Development Authority (BARDA) and other government customers that are providing  patients  with innovative and advanced drug development solutions.

In January, the Public Health Agency of Canada signed  a contract with Meridian Medical Technologies, Inc. for the purchase of approximately  $33 million of SIGA’s lead product, oral TPOXX, to protect Canada’s military and civilian population from smallpox. This contract award should help increase SIGA’s revenue and create greater awareness of  TPOXX around the world.

SIGA’s total revenue increased significantly year-over-year to $37.8 million in the fourth quarter ended December 31, 2020. It reported  operating income of $26.8 million for the quarter  compared to an operating loss of $3.4 million in the fourth quarter ended 2019. Its net income came in at $20.1 million for this period. The company’s EPS was  $0.26 compared to a loss per share of $0.06.

Jounce Therapeutics, Inc. (JNCE)

Incorporated in 2012, JNCE is a clinical-stage immunotherapy company that develops therapies for treating cancer. Its clinical-stage monoclonal antibody vopratelimabis is in its Phase II clinical trials. The company is also developing  JTX-4014, an anti-PD-1 antibody for combination therapy.

Last month, JNCE closed a public offering of 5.75 million shares of its common stock. Gross proceeds from the offering were approximately $64.7 million.

In January, JNCE initiated the patient enrollment in its  Phase 1 INNATE study of JTX-8064 (LILRB2/ILT4 Inhibitor) Monotherapy and PD-1 Inhibitor Combination Therapy in patients with advanced solid tumors. This study should help the company to cater to the large and growing unmet medical need and by so doing stand out in the biotech industry.

In the fourth quarter ended December 31, 2020, JNCE generated license and collaboration revenue of $62.34 million. It reported a net income of $35.47 million, compared to a net loss of $22.67 million in the prior-year quarter. Furthermore,  its operating income came in at $35.42 million, compared to a loss of $23.53 in the same quarter in the previous year. The company’s EPS came in at $0.86 for this period.

BioDelivery Sciences International, Inc. (BDSI)

BDSI is a specialty pharmaceutical company that develops  and commercializes pharmaceutical products for the treatment of chronic conditions in the U.S. and internationally. The company offers products based on its patented BioErodible MucoAdhesive drug-delivery technology. It also offers products, such as BELBUCA, a buprenorphine buccal film for the treatment of chronic pain, and Symproic, a peripherally acting mu-opioid receptor for treating opioid-induced constipation in adult patients with chronic non-cancer pain.

During the fourth quarter, ended December 31, 2020, BDSI’s net revenue increased 33% year-over-year to $42.2 million. Its EBITDA for this quarter was $14.3 million, or 34% of net sales, compared to $4.1 million or 13% of net sales, in the fourth quarter of 2019. The company reported net income of $10.2 million, compared to a net loss of $696,000 in the same quarter in the previous year.
